Loading...
Documented in 2 files:
- arch/hexagon/include/asm/bitops.h, line 76
- include/asm-generic/bitops/instrumented-atomic.h, line 89
Defined in 1 files as a prototype:
Defined in 4 files as a macro:
- arch/arm/include/asm/bitops.h, line 196 (as a macro)
- arch/m68k/include/asm/bitops.h, line 307 (as a macro)
- arch/m68k/include/asm/bitops.h, line 309 (as a macro)
- arch/m68k/include/asm/bitops.h, line 311 (as a macro)
Defined in 11 files as a function:
- arch/alpha/include/asm/bitops.h, line 245 (as a function)
- arch/hexagon/include/asm/bitops.h, line 81 (as a function)
- arch/mips/include/asm/bitops.h, line 260 (as a function)
- arch/openrisc/include/asm/bitops/atomic.h, line 103 (as a function)
- arch/parisc/include/asm/bitops.h, line 90 (as a function)
- arch/sh/include/asm/bitops-cas.h, line 78 (as a function)
- arch/sh/include/asm/bitops-grb.h, line 140 (as a function)
- arch/sh/include/asm/bitops-llsc.h, line 119 (as a function)
- arch/sparc/include/asm/bitops_32.h, line 72 (as a function)
- arch/sparc/lib/bitops.S, line 58 (as a function)
- include/asm-generic/bitops/instrumented-atomic.h, line 96 (as a function)
Referenced in 10 files:
- arch/arm64/include/asm/sync_bitops.h, line 23
- arch/hexagon/include/asm/bitops.h
- arch/m68k/include/asm/bitops.h, line 319
- arch/sparc/lib/bitops.S
- drivers/block/drbd/drbd_req.c, line 935
- drivers/net/ethernet/qlogic/qed/qed_rdma.c, line 1015
- include/net/bluetooth/hci_core.h, line 814
- kernel/kcsan/kcsan_test.c
- kernel/kcsan/selftest.c
- mm/kasan/kasan_test_c.c, line 1625